N.Z. MEAT FOR GERMANY.

"WELLINGTON", December 20. The High Coranrkeianer writes to tho Hon. J. M"Gowan that the dreulaw "ooing distributed in German amongst, odilnns of leading German papers when on a visit to England, with a view to securing a market for New Zealand moat in Germany, are bearing good fruit. Tho German rross are now giving much attention to the question, induced by tho extraordinary height to which prices have increased, tind references to New Zealand meat are numerous. Mr Reeves says be is keeping in touch with tho question, and has considerable hope that the opposition of tho agrarian party to tlie introduction of foreign meat will be overcome.
